Negotiable
Undetermined
Remote
Remote or Blue Bell, Pennsylvania
Summary: We are seeking 2 highly skilled Senior Software Development Engineers in Test (Sr SDETs) who integrate AI as a core component of their workflow. The ideal candidates will utilize tools like GitHub Copilot and Claude Code to efficiently develop automation frameworks, test suites, and command-line interface (CLI) tools. This role emphasizes the creation of AI-assisted testing solutions and collaboration with development teams to enhance testing processes. Candidates should have a strong background in automation engineering and a passion for leveraging AI technologies.
Key Responsibilities:
- Build and maintain API & integration tests using Karate (DSL, JUnit5, Maven, Cucumber, JDBC)
- Develop UI automation using Playwright (Python)
- Create AI-assisted CLI tools (Python) for testing, data validation, and log parsing
- Integrate automation into Jenkins CI/CD pipelines and ensure stability
- Generate test scripts from OpenAPI specs, JIRA stories, and requirements using AI tools
- Design and manage synthetic test data (JSON/XML/Oracle scripts)
- Develop contract tests for microservices (Kubernetes/OpenShift)
- Collaborate with dev teams to shift testing left
Key Skills:
- 3+ years in SDET / Automation Engineering
- Strong hands-on experience with Karate Framework
- Playwright (Python) for UI automation
- Advanced Python scripting (CLI tools, REST APIs)
- Jenkins CI/CD pipeline development & debugging
- Experience with Docker, Kubernetes/OpenShift
- Daily hands-on usage of GitHub Copilot & Claude Code
- Experience with Bitbucket/Git workflows
Salary (Rate): undetermined
City: undetermined
Country: undetermined
Working Arrangements: remote
IR35 Status: undetermined
Seniority Level: undetermined
Industry: IT
About the Role
We re looking for 2 highly skilled Sr SDETs who use AI as a core part of their workflow not just a tool. This role is ideal for engineers who can leverage GitHub Copilot and Claude Code to rapidly build automation frameworks, test suites, and CLI tools.
Key Responsibilities
- Build and maintain API & integration tests using Karate (DSL, JUnit5, Maven, Cucumber, JDBC)
- Develop UI automation using Playwright (Python)
- Create AI-assisted CLI tools (Python) for testing, data validation, and log parsing
- Integrate automation into Jenkins CI/CD pipelines and ensure stability
- Generate test scripts from OpenAPI specs, JIRA stories, and requirements using AI tools
- Design and manage synthetic test data (JSON/XML/Oracle scripts)
- Develop contract tests for microservices (Kubernetes/OpenShift)
- Collaborate with dev teams to shift testing left
AI-Driven Expectations
- Generate Karate feature suites from OpenAPI specs within an hour
- Build Python CLI tools using AI in a single session
- Debug failures using AI-assisted root cause analysis
- Review and refine AI-generated code to maintain high quality standards
Required Skills
- 3+ years in SDET / Automation Engineering
- Strong hands-on experience with Karate Framework
- Playwright (Python) for UI automation
- Advanced Python scripting (CLI tools, REST APIs)
- Jenkins CI/CD pipeline development & debugging
- Experience with Docker, Kubernetes/OpenShift
- Daily hands-on usage of GitHub Copilot & Claude Code
- Experience with Bitbucket/Git workflows
Nice to Have
- Oracle/SQL (JDBC assertions)
- Spring Boot testing (@SpringBootTest)
- Observability tools (Dynatrace, Kibana)
- Helm / GitOps exposure
- Messaging systems like RabbitMQ